Which of the following pairs of molecules are structural isomers? Select all that apply.
2-methylpentane and 2-methylhexane
2,3-dimethylbutane and 2-methylpentane
2-methylpentane and 3-methylpentane
hexane and 2-methylhexane
option 2 and option 3 are correct answer
structural isomers is nothing but two compounds should have sam emolecular formula but different in their structure
